Cortisol
A steroid hormone released by the adrenal glands in response to stress or low blood glucose; involved in the regulation of metabolism, immune response, and stress response.
Eustress
Positive stress which is perceived as beneficial for the experiencer, often associated with improved performance or well-being.
Activating Event
An incident in the external environment or a thought that triggers a psychological response.
General Adaptation Syndrome (GAS)
General Adaptation Syndrome (GAS) is a theoretical model describing the body's short-term and long-term reactions to stress, including stages of alarm, resistance, and exhaustion.
